We're on Midgehole Road in the Hebden Dale valley, between Hebden Bridge town centre and Hardcastle Crags National Trust woodland. The postcode is HX7 7AA. Detailed directions including the steep access road are provided when you book, so you know what to expect before arrival.

Yes. Hebden Bridge railway station is about 20-25 minutes' walk through town, or a 5-minute taxi ride. Valley Taxis (01422 844070) and Hebden Cars (01422 845555) serve the area. The 595 bus stops on Midgehole Road at the top of the access lane.

A riverside and woodland path takes you into Hebden Bridge town centre in 10-15 minutes on foot (approximately 0.7 miles). The path is mostly flat and follows the valley into town. Many guests walk in for breakfast or an evening meal without needing the car.
-
Yes, Hardcastle Crags National Trust woodland is directly accessible from Springwood Studios. The main estate paths and Gibson Mill are approximately 1 mile from the property. You can walk straight from the door into the crags without needing to drive or find parking.
-
The nearest shop is in Hebden Bridge (10-15 minute walk), where you'll find supermarkets, independent food shops, and a weekly market. There's no corner shop within immediate walking distance, so most guests bring supplies or pick them up in Hebden Bridge on arrival.
